Department of Dental Medicine
The Department of Dental Medicine (Dentmed) creates dental care for the future through state-of-the-art education and meaningful research. In addition, the University Dental Clinic offers a student clinic open to the public where students practice supervised by experienced instructors.

Interventions for aerosols generated during clinical practice
Interventions for aerosols generated during clinical practice
Researchers at the KI Department of Dental Medicine, in collaboration with researchers at the University of Zurich, have published a systematic review in the Journal of Dental Research, providing evidence for interventions that can reduce microbes transmitted via aerosols generated during clinical practice.
